■■●■■●■—■■■—■■——■●——■●—■■●■_
ChinascjenceandTechnologyRoview虚拟现实技术在电网监控中的应用
冀明,孔凡伟,庄磊。
(1.河北衡水供电公司河北衡水053000:2.邯郸供电公司河北邯郸056035)应用技术
q●I
[摘要]根据图形显示领域的现实技术和电力网络监控系统的建模手段,结合电力企业信息化,网络化的需求,提出了基于虚拟现实技术的公共信息交互平台设计方案。VRML是面向对象的一种语言,它类似w髓超级链接所使用的HTML语言,也是一种基于文本的语言,并可以运行在多种平台之上,只不过能够更多的为虚拟现实环境服务。
[关键词]信息交互平台VRML虚拟现实技术wEB
中图分类号:u665.12文献标识码:A文章编号:1009~914x(20lo)03一0207~02
引言
网络系统是实现信息化的重要基础设施,如今网络规模日益扩大,结构日益复杂,其功能也愈来愈强,网络管理已成为网络系统的关键部分。对于有效管理大规模网络元素来说网络管理界面是必须的,网络管理用户得到数量巨大的信息,这就需要用表示工具来尽量的组织、总结并简化这些信息,理想的方法是把重点放在图形表示上。网络管理系统中人机交互界面以图形用户界面(GraphicsuserInterface,GuI)为主,直观的图形界面可以表示网络的拓扑结构和运行状态,并为网络管理人员提供方便的信息查询、设置网络设备参数及显示网络运行状态的手段。但传统的网络管理信息的显示以二维图形界面为主,随着网络规模、网络元素数量的日益增加以及它们之间连接关系越发复杂,网络管理的实现变得越来越困难,大量复杂信息的方便快捷显示和管理成为二维界面的瓶颈,因此网管系统的界面也应不断采用新技术加以更新、改造,界面的优劣将直接影响人们对系统的第一印象,影响人们对系统的使用,引入新的技术提高系统界面的功能、界面的可观赏性、系统的易使用程度是网管系统成败的关键因素,这就迫使人们寻求远远超越典型二维界面的信息显示途径。
现在网络操作者已经开始研究三维图形用户界面,Derieta1.是第一个提出
应用三维技术概念的人,三维界面具有以下优点:
(1)具有信息的完整、直观性显示特点,网管信息中存在大量三维空间的信息,当在二维界面显示时这些信息都要先转化为平面格式,这就丢失了部分原始信息,而在三维中则可完整显示。
(2)可以将大量零星分散的数据信息结合起来形成综合直观的显示。
(3)可以直观显示多层网络结构。
除了以上这些,三维显示还具有许多优势,如可以以某种非常接近于现实的方式显示复杂信息,可以改变视角,移动视点等,因此如果能将三维技术应用到网管系统中,必将给网络管理员提供更为有效的管理手段。本课题探讨了电力通信网络监控管理系统中三维网管系统的设计与实现。
1虚拟现实技术
虚拟现实(VirtualReality,VR)是近来计算机网络世界的热点之一,在社会生活的许多方面有着非常美好的发展前景。虚拟现实是计算机模拟的三维环境,式显示的迫切要求,是应用三维GuI还是二维取决于不同的场合,在下面这些方面应用VR技术克服了传统二维界面的局限。虚拟现实技术具有
嘲卜l=壤予舛连接黼
}獬卜2啦拟渺界tl,的f聃连接鼬
以下四个重要特征:
1.1存在感
它是指用户感到作为主角存在于模拟环境中的真实程度,理想的模拟环境应该达到使用户难以分辨真假的程度。
1.2交互性
交互性是指用户对模拟环境内物体的可操作程度和从环境得到反馈的自然程度(包括实时性)。
1.3多感知性
所谓多感知性就是说除了一般计算机所具有的视觉感知外,还有听觉感知、力觉感知、触觉感知、运动感知、甚至包括味觉感知、嗅觉感知等。
1.4自主性
是指虚拟环境中物体依据物理定律动作的程度。例如,当受到力的推动时,物体会沿力的方向移动、或翻倒、或从桌面落到地面等。用户通过传感装置直接对虚拟环境进行操作,并得到实时三维显示和其它反馈信息(如触觉、力觉反馈等)。当系统与外部世界通过传感装置构成反馈闭环时,在用户的控制下,用户与虚拟环境问的交互可以对外部世界产生作用(如遥操作等)。虚拟现实系统主要由以下五个模块构成:
(1)检测模块:检测用户的操作命令,并通过传感器模块作用于虚拟环境。
(2)反馈模块:接受来自传感器模块信息,为用户提供实时反馈。
(3)传感器模块:一方面接受来自用户的操作命令,并将其作用于虚拟环境:
另一方面将操作后产生的结果以各种反馈形式提供给用户。
(4)控制模块:对传感器进行控制,使其对用户、虚拟环境和现实世界产生作用。
(5)建模模块:获取现实世界组成部分的三维表示,并由此构成对应的虚拟环境。
2VR技术在电力网络监控系统中的应用
在网络监控管理系统中应用VR技术来源于人们对管理信息如何以一一个有效方式显示的迫切要求,是应用三维GUI还是二维取决于不同的场合,在下面这些方面应用VR技术克服了传统二维界面的局限。
网络管理中经常遇到各种层结构信息,用二维方式显示具有层次结构关系的信息有以下的不足:无法清楚表示不同信息层问的连接结构,连接图难于理解:如果树状图包含很多节点,将会使树图又宽又长。而VRML可以用自己的等级结构形式显示这些信息,不论要显示的信息数量多大都可方便显示。图卜1显示了网络连接被分为链路连接(Linkconnection)和子网连接(subNetworkconnection,sNc)的传统二维结构图。
当节点和sNc数目很多时,在二维显示方式中就会生成复杂的多层结构,很难直观理解和浏览。而利用虚拟现实建模语言构建的子网连接图可以方便的实现各层次间的浏览,如图1—2所示,子网以云状物替代,链路连接以管道代表。每个元素可是设置一个超链接,当触发时可以跳转到相应HTML上查看节点详细信息。
3系统实现的功能
网络管理员通过三维图形用户界面可以完成基本的网络监控管理功能,实现复杂网络信息的逼真显示,给用户提供了一个极具沉浸感和方便快捷的三维图形界面,用户可以在三维虚拟空间中任意走动,从各个角度观察网络设备及其运行状况。系统具备的基本功能:
故障显示功能:现场发生故障的设备可以及时在虚拟场景中相应节点对象处变色显示并发出声音报警,同时将用户视点自动转移到此节点,并在二维界面显示具体故障信息。配置功能:查看或修改某一设备的系统数据库参数时,可以通过点击虚拟环境中此设备的活动节点,在弹出界面中进行参数查看和修改操作。
参考文献
[1]Hartman,Jedandwernecke,Josie,y刚L2.OHandb00k,Addlson—Wesley,ReadingMasachusetes,1996.
科技博览l
207 万方数据
万方数据
虚拟现实技术在电网监控中的应用
作者:冀明, 孔凡伟, 庄磊
作者单位:冀明,孔凡伟(河北衡水供电公司,河北,衡水,053000), 庄磊(邯郸供电公司,河北,邯郸,056035)
刊名:
中国科技博览
英文刊名:ZHONGGUO BAOZHUANG KEJI BOLAN
年,卷(期):2010(3)
参考文献(9条)
1.宗志方;季晖;谭江天VPAIL.资源手册 1998
2.黄铁军;柳键VRML.国际标准与应用指南 1999
3.Andrea L A;David R N;John L The VRML 2.0 Sourcebook 1995
4.杨克俭;刘舒燕虚拟现实中的建模方法[期刊论文]-武汉工业大学学报 2001(06)
5.邱进冬;杨志雄;顾新建基干Web的虚拟现实的开发与应用[期刊论文]-计算机应用研究 2003(03)
6.G.Bell;A.Parisi;M.Pesce The Virtual Reality Modeling Language(VRML) 1995
7.施演;周葆芳;赵志勇VRML2.0.使用速成 1999
8.Koike,H An Application of Three-Dimensional Visualization to Object-Oriented Programming 1992
9.Hartman,Jed;Wernecke,Josie VRML 2.0 Handbook 1996
本文链接:https://www.doczj.com/doc/7f9861150.html,/Periodical_zgbzkjbl201003184.aspx